What is a sensory neuron?

Chemistry
1 answer:
ASHA 777 [7]4 years ago
4 0

Answer: Nerve cells within the nervous system that are in charge of converting external stimuli from the organism's environment into internal electrical impulses.

Photosynthesis is the process by which green plants manufacture their food using carbon dioxide and water in the presence of sunlight.

It is expressed using the equation below;

      6CO₂   +   6H₂O     →      C₆H₁₂O₆  +  6O₂

         reactants                      products

1. Compounds consumed are carbon dioxide and water.

2. Product is glucose and oxygen.

3. Most organism obtain their nourishment directly and indirectly from photosynthetic activities.

Plants are the producers of food in the ecosystem. If the process of photosynthesis does not occur, there is no way other organisms will obtain their own nourishment.
